General Comments.
(
Brief data summary and
scan listing.)
This project consists of 9 stations: Ef, Wb, Yb, Ma, Wz, On, Mc, Ur, Sh (Nt not observed). Used 8-MHz 4 bands x 1 Pol. (RCP) with 2-bits sampling.
Ef is a reference antenna.
Data in IF1-3 were available in Ma. Sh and Ur observed for 70% and 35% of the allocated time range because of source elevation limits.
ERI=0.73 (Ef=1.00, Wb=1.00, Yb=1.00, Ma=0.75, Wz=1.00, On=1.00, Mc=1.00, Ur=0.68, Sh=0.30), ERI*=0.73 (artificial errors only).
